Modern technology has given telescammers the tools to call you.
Since those telescammers are criminals, they ignore both the Do Not Call list and any request you might make.
Modern technology can also protect you, if YOU do a few simple things!
The first thing to do is buy a call blocker device, service or app.
Then, use it correctly.

Google "call blocker" for more information.
http://goo.gl/cdPm8O

If you cannot afford or use such a tool, then:
* Do not answer calls from unknown numbers ... let them go to voicemail or answering service
* Do NOT return calls from unknown numbers!  All that does is verify your phone number!  And, in some cases, those return calls may cost $20 or more to complete.
* If you have a "dumb" cell phone, assign the scammer's number to a group named "scammers" (or similar).  Then, assign a silent ringtone to that group.

I received several calls from this number, I did not answer until this last time.  The individual speaking with an accent stated that I was to receive a grant of $8000 from the US government.  I ask him what the catch was and he stated I would have to speak to someone else about the details.  I told him I was not interested and to remove me from his call list and he proceeded to curse me out using the "F" word a number of times and then hung up the phone.  Several days ago I got a phone call from someone with a California exchange that had the same accent and actually sounded like the same individual and he told me his was a friend, that he met me before in the town where I currently live.  I ask him where I met him at and he proceeded to tell me that he was a chef.  Well unless he was the chef at McDs I did not know this individual either and he proceeded to hang up after I told him I did not wanted to be removed from his call list.

This number called a few times, I didn't pick up and they didn't leave a message.  Finally, I decided to pick up.  I asked for the company name, US Department of Health (so they claim).  I asked them to take me off their "call list" and for a return number to verify that they should have my information.  I was given 202-666-9147.  I did not call them back.  

I received a call today and then asked for a return phone number.  The rep said,"the number for now?" I followed up,"Now? What does that mean?" I was given an international random number (not even enough digits for a call.  I then asked for a mailing address, the rep said he would transfer me to a supervisor.  I asked the supervisor, he responded, "Austin TX".. I asked for a street address, the response was Park Ave.  I asked for a physically US mailing address where this company exists.  They hang up.
